Draft script for the 1974 film, here under the working title "Molly, Gid & Johnny." Copy belonging to hair stylist Philip Leto, with his annotations in manuscript ink throughout, marking completed scenes. Based on the 1962 novel "Leaving Cheyenne" by Larry McMurtry. A pair of Texas farm boys vie for the affection of the beautiful and headstrong Molly, with their rivalry spanning nearly 40 years. Shot on location in Bastrop, Texas. Mustard Studio Duplicating Service titled wrappers. Title page present, with credits for screenwriter Steve Friedman and author Larry McMurtry. 136 leaves, with last page of text numbered 135. Mimeograph duplication, rectos only. Pages Near Fine, wrapper Very Good plus, lightly edgeworn, bound with two gold screw brads.

Vintage press kit for the 1979 film. Black-and-white illustrated pocketed folder, containing 21 black and white photographs, and 16 gatherings of promotional reading material. Based on Richard Condon's 1974 novel. A pitch-black satire, following the half-brother of fictional US President Kegan (closely modeled on John F. Kennedy) as he begins to uncover the circumstances which led to Kegan's assassination 19 years prior. Folder, photographs, and promotional material Near Fine. Spicer US Neo-Noir.
